Isolation and characterization of a heptaglycosylceramide from bovine erythrocyte membranes.

J L Chien, S C Li, Y T Li.   

Abstract

A heptaglycosylceramide was isolated from bovine erythrocyte membranes. The structure was characterized to be Gal(alpha 1-3)Gal(beta 1-4)GlcNAc(beta1-3)Gal(beta 1-4)Glc-NAc(beta 1-4)al(beta 1-4)GlcCer. A hexaglycosylceramide that has the same sequence except for the terminal alpha-galactosyl unit has also been isolated. We have previously found that gangliosides isolated from bovine erythrocyte membranes contain a keratan sulfate type repeating unit --[3Gal(beta 1-4)-GlcNAc beta]--n. This study shows that the keratan sulfate type repeating unit is also present in the neutral glycosphingolipids of bovine erythrocyte membranes.
